MANILA – President Ferdinand Marcos Jr. designated Deputy Ombudsman for the Visayas Dante Vargas as acting Ombudsman, Malacañang confirmed on Wednesday.
Marcos names acting Ombudsman
"Confirmed," was Presidential Communications Office (PCO) Undersecretary Claire Castro's reply in a text message to reporters.
Vargas was appointed to the Office of the Ombudsman by former president Rodrigo Duterte in March 2022.

He will take over special prosecutor Mariflor Punzalan-Castillo who has been sitting as officer-in-charge of the anti-graft court since late July after Samuel Martires completed his mandated seven-year term.
Vargas shall oversee affairs at the agency until Marcos names a permanent Ombudsman.
